Use when

Growing infra teams whose Terraform repos have outgrown manual reviews and need policy-as-code, drift detection, and safer concurrent runs.

Avoid when

Small teams with a handful of Terraform modules — Atlantis or HCP Terraform free tier is cheaper and adequate.

What is Spacelift?

Spacelift is a managed IaC orchestration platform built specifically for Terraform, OpenTofu, Pulumi, CloudFormation, Ansible, and Kubernetes. Unlike generic CI, it understands state, drift, policies via Open Policy Agent, and dependency graphs between stacks. Companies adopt it when their Terraform footprint outgrows what Atlantis or raw GitHub Actions can safely handle.

Key features

Stack dependencies and drift detection
OPA-based policies on plans and pushes
Private workers for VPC-only access
Self-service stacks via Blueprints
Terragrunt and OpenTofu first-class support
